About THE BRADFORD CHORALE
THE BRADFORD CHORALE is a registered charity in England and Wales (registration number 517197). Based on official Charity Commission data, it holds a "Good Standing" rating with a CharityScore of 67/100 — a charity in good standing with solid but not exceptional governance indicators. This reflects adequate performance across most criteria, though some areas fall short of the strongest-rated charities. In its most recent reporting year (2023), THE BRADFORD CHORALE reported a total income of £10,367 and total expenditure of £10,534, a spending ratio of 102% which is broadly in line with its income. According to the Charity Commission register, THE BRADFORD CHORALE describes its activities as follows: AN SATB CHOIR PERFORMING CONCERTS SEVERAL TIMES A YEAR AT VARIOUS VENUES IN THE WEST YORKSHIRE REGION. Our analysis found no significant governance concerns for THE BRADFORD CHORALE. No regulatory actions, filing failures, or financial anomalies were detected in the available public data.
